My Birds of the Americas IV exhibit officially opens this weekend and is now
ready for viewing. This year a main focus of my exhibit is images from Mary's
Point, a migration pit stop for sandpipers on their way to Central and South
America. The exhibit also has images from New England, The Outer Banks in
North
Carolina, Florida, Galapagos, Costa Rica and coastal and rain forest areas of
my native Peru. The exhibit is officially open from October 31 to December 5
in
the Education Wing of the Boston Nature Center. In addition to images for the
exhibit, I also have more than one hundred unframed prints of birds of the
Americas available for public viewing. My sandpiper migration presentation is
scheduled for Sunday November 7 from 2-3 PM. Hope to see you there!
